Hi there,
So, some of the blogs you follow are left out of the grid view. However, they are present in the list view (you can make this switch from your Widgets page). This is the intended behavior if a blog administrator does not have a Gravatar account setup. So, if you follow a self-hosted blog that is not on WordPress.com and the owner has not setup a Gravatar account, the widget doesn’t have an image to display. Therefore, it omits the site from the grid view.
There isn’t a way to force the widget to display these blogs unless you switch to the list view.
